Output 51ff34d8d4dd156abb3aad0c1cc7cc6d3ad945cac247c64a63a37a690f1fd3e4:0

value
15845082
script pubkey
OP_0 OP_PUSHBYTES_20 c36ed46f289467f246a98ab6e2f32fa4052350ad
address
bc1qcdhdgmegj3nly34f32mw9ue05szjx59dj5v36t
transaction
51ff34d8d4dd156abb3aad0c1cc7cc6d3ad945cac247c64a63a37a690f1fd3e4
spent
true